[alsa-devel] [PATCH v2 01/11] ASoC: phycore-ac97: Add DT support

Markus Pargmann mpa at pengutronix.de
Sun Apr 7 21:25:11 CEST 2013


Add devicetree support for this audio soc fabric driver.

Signed-off-by: Markus Pargmann <mpa at pengutronix.de>
---

Notes:
    Changes in v2:
     - Simplify the driver, by combining audmux port configurations. The
       audmux driver actually knows on which platform he is running and
       will return the appropriate error code if we use functions for
       another platform. So we don't need to have the knowledge about it
       in phycore-ac97 and can try both functions. This removes the need
       of different compatibilities and renames it to imx27-ac97.
     - Use a phandle for the cpu_dai link.
     - Add devicetree binding documentation.
     - Rename binding to phytec,phycore-ac97 and fsl,ssi to phytec,ssi

+Phytec phycore AC97
+
+Required properties:
+- compatible: "phytec,phycore-ac97"
+- phytec,ssi: A phandle to the ssi device that is connected to ac97.
+
+Example:
+
+sound {
+	compatible = "phytec,phycore-ac97";
+	phytec,ssi = <&ssi1>;
+};
